Commercial Slab Construction in Ann Arbor, MI

Commercial slab construction services involve creating the foundational concrete surfaces used for various types of commercial buildings and facilities. This typically includes the installation of concrete slabs for warehouses, retail stores, office buildings, parking lots, and other large-scale structures. Property owners often request this service to establish a durable, level base for their projects, ensuring stability and longevity for the structures that will be built on top. Before requesting a slab construction, it’s helpful to understand the specific requirements of the project, such as load-bearing needs, site conditions, and any local building codes that may influence the design and installation process.

Property owners should consider factors like soil conditions, drainage, and the intended use of the space when planning for a commercial slab. Proper preparation and design are essential to prevent issues such as cracking or uneven settling over time. It’s also important to clarify the scope of work, including any necessary excavation, reinforcement, and finishing details, to ensure the finished slab meets the project’s specifications. Understanding these elements can help property owners make informed decisions and achieve a durable, functional foundation for their commercial construction needs.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and storage facilities on commercial properties.

How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ness of a commercial slab varies based on its intended use, typically ranging from 4 to 12 inches for durability and load capacity.

What materials are used in commercial slab construction? Concrete is the primary material, often reinforced with steel rebar or mesh to enhance strength and longevity.

What should property owners consider before construction? It’s important to evaluate soil conditions, drainage needs, and the specific load requirements for the intended use of the slab.
